Compost soup/tea is common. Makes a concentrated nutrient heavy water which you can use to water plants for instant nutrient application. You don't want to keep it in the compost bin or worm farm though. Too much water and can drown the worms.
Not with live worms in it. This was done in error. But usually yes, compost tea is common. This is the juice thats drained off the compost bin from overwatering tho. It happens.

Worms and springtails. Looks like a scoop out of a compost bin maybe. My guess is this person is about to make a little worm or springtail culture, or separate these from the bin for feeding a pet.
It's not a big deal to touch this. If you've ever in your life touched dirt. You've touched this. But with that dark, great looking soil and the sheer volume of helpful worms and springtails here, this has to be an intentionally cultured colony that this person has cared for. So not only is this just dirt, but this is the healthiest, most bioactive "clean" dirt there is. Literally no big deal.
